BLUE BELL, Pa. (WPVI) -- A woman from Montgomery County celebrated her 100th birthday a little early Sunday.
Grace Ricci Bergman was born on December 3, 1915 - the third of ten children - and grew up in Lansdale.
During the Great Depression, Bergman established a club of women to collect food and donations.
During World War Two, she enlisted in the Marines, and served from 1943 to 1945.
Sources tell Action News Bergman, who was married for 46 years and has one daughter, is the longest living female Marine in the state of Pennsylvania.
